Boulder Flamethrower Attack: What We Know So Far

A horrific attack on Boulder's Pearl Street Mall on Sunday afternoon has left eight people injured, with the suspect, Mohamed Sabry Soliman, facing serious charges. According to jail records, Soliman, an Egyptian citizen residing in the U.S. illegally on an expired tourist visa, has been booked on suspicion of eight felonies, including first-degree murder and assault. He is being held on a $10 million bond.

The attack, which federal officials are investigating as a targeted act of violence and terrorism, occurred at 1:26 p.m. near the Boulder County Historic Courthouse. Soliman allegedly threw an incendiary device and used a makeshift flamethrower, setting people on fire. Witnesses reported Soliman yelling "Free Palestine" during the incident. The victims, identified as four men and four women aged 52 to 88, were participating in a Run for Their Lives demonstration, a national movement advocating for the release of Israeli hostages held by Hamas.

The FBI is involved in the investigation, with agents conducting court-authorized law enforcement activity in El Paso County, where Soliman resided. Several victims were treated at local hospitals, including Boulder Community Health and UCHealth University of Colorado Hospitals burn unit. While all victims treated at Boulder Community Health have been transferred or discharged, the conditions of those still hospitalized are currently unknown. The attack occurred just before the Jewish holiday of Shavuot, prompting a statement from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u, who condemned the attack and expressed solidarity with the victims.
